AL office in Nilphamari besieged

Agitated supporters of the president of Awami League (AL) district unit Dewan Kamal Ahmed yesterday besieged the party office demanding lone selection of the incumbent mayor as party candidate in the upcoming mayoral election.
At that time, a meeting of the party's municipal unit was going on over selection of the party's mayoral candidate. Local lawmaker and central cultural secretary Asaduzzaman Noor along with other senior party leaders of the district were present at the meeting.
AL sources said, the party's district committee called a meeting at10:00 am yesterday at their district office to choose a prospective mayoral candidate for the municipal election here and send his name to the central committee of the party for a final decision.
Party's Sadar upazila unit general secretary Alimuddin Basunia who was present at the meeting said to this correspondent that names of three aspirant mayoral candidates were taken into consideration. They were incumbent mayor and district Awami League president Dewan Kamal Ahmed, former Chattra League (BCL) leader and freedom fighter Aminur Rahman and Principal Anisuzzaman Rumi.
Later, the meeting decided not to choose a lone candidate but to send the names of all three aspirant candidates to the central committee for final selection, Basunia said.
As the news spread all over, supporters of Dewan Kamal who were waiting outside the party office burst into protest. They instantly besieged the party office for some time demanding instant declaration of Dewan Kamal as party's mayoral candidate for sending his name to Dhaka. When the collapsible gate of the entrance to the party office was closed, there arose a hue and cry.
However, agitated supporters of Dewan Kamal calmed down when lawmaker Asaduzzaman Noor assured that the central selection committee is wise enough to select the right candidate.
Contacted, Dewan Kamal said his supporters gathered at their own will in a peaceful manner to hear the party decision only.
A contingent of police was present at the time of agitation.
